BROOKLYN, NY–Graduate student Dominika Pawlowska combined for a 12-3 overall record at the Shark Tank Challenge hosted by LIU inside the Steinberg Wellness Center.
The Highlanders competed against Rutgers, Stevens, Drew, Wellesley and host LIU. The lone victory on the day came against Rutgers (17-10).
Pawlowska led the Highlanders with 12 overall victories in the epee competition followed by Gala Krsmanovic who combined for a 10-5 mark. The epee squad recorded a 29-16 overall mark on the day, competing against Rutgers, Stevens, Drew, Wellesley and host LIU.
Freshman Stella Frias, hailing from Sao Paulo, Brazil, made her collegiate debut in the foil competition, registering eight victories. Elena Fernandez Negron went 7-4 on the day.
